Introduction to Cooper Tires and Big O Tires

To understand the potential connection between Cooper Tires and Big O Tires, it’s essential to have a brief overview of each company. Cooper Tires is a global tire manufacturer with a long history dating back to 1914. It is known for producing high-quality tires for passenger vehicles, light trucks, and SUVs, offering a broad range of products that cater to various driving conditions and consumer preferences.

Big O Tires, on the other hand, is primarily a retail tire chain with locations across the United States and Canada. Founded in 1962, Big O Tires has grown to become one of the largest tire retail chains, offering a vast array of tires from multiple manufacturers. Their business model focuses on providing excellent customer service, competitive pricing, and a wide selection of tires to fit different vehicle types and driving needs.

Big O Tires Retail Model and Tire Selection

Big O Tires operates as a tire retail chain, which means it sources its tires from various manufacturers. Big O Tires stores carry a broad selection of tire brands, including well-known names like Michelin, Goodyear, and Cooper Tires, along with its own private label brands. This diverse product range allows Big O Tires to offer customers a wide choice of tires that fit their budget, vehicle type, and driving preferences.

The relationship between Big O Tires and tire manufacturers like Cooper Tires is based on a supply and distribution agreement. Big O Tires purchases tires from these manufacturers and then sells them to customers through its retail outlets. This model enables Big O Tires to maintain a competitive edge in the market by offering a variety of products from different brands.

Does Cooper Tires manufacture Big O Tires?

Cooper Tires does manufacture some tires that are branded as Big O Tires, but not all Big O Tires are made by Cooper. Big O Tires is a private label brand, which means that the tires are designed and sold by Big O Tires, but may be manufactured by various partner companies, including Cooper Tires. Cooper Tires is one of the manufacturers that produces Big O Tires, but other manufacturers may also be involved in the production of Big O Tires products.

The Big O Tires brand is owned by TBC Corporation, a tire distributor and retailer that operates a network of tire retail locations, including Big O Tires. TBC Corporation partners with various tire manufacturers, including Cooper Tires, to produce tires that meet the quality and performance standards of the Big O Tires brand. These tires are then sold through Big O Tires retail locations, providing consumers with a range of tire options that are designed to meet their specific needs and budgets.
